It’s a wonder that Pokemon first gen worked at all, the code is basically held together with duct tape. There are a few really good LPs and speedruns that show off just how glitchy the game is. It basically has no error handling at all so it’ll take almost any garbage data and try to use it in some way.
For me the biggest Pokemon development thing was how Iwata was able to get Gold’s code down to such a small size that they were able to fit Kanto onto the same cartridge!
